High-quality materials
High-quality materials give HAURATON’s individually manufactured channels their unique appearance and reliable performance.

Customised stainless steel channels are made of stainless chromium-nickel steel in material grades 304 (V2A) and 316 (V4A) which ensures the systems are corrosion-resistant.

The galvanised steel slotted inlet has gone through the process of hot-dip galvanising to ensure long-term corrosion protection and protection against considerable stress loads.

Corten steel is a steel alloy that is characterised by high resistance to weathering. Its surface is coated with a particularly dense layer of iron oxide which is responsible for its high rust resistance. It acts as a barrier layer and gives the product the desired rust-red appearance.
In addition to the steel material, the appearance of the drainage system can be individually adapted to aesthetic requirements. Different finishes include sandblasted, brushed, polished, glass bead blasted, pickled or coated.
